On behalf of all Arizonans, the Arizona Game & Fish Department manages over 800 species of wildlife including mountain lion and bobcats. To remove the management of these cats from their purview, would not only disrupt the balance their wildlife managers seek on a daily basis, it would also have a negative impact on the other 798 + species they manage.

Sportsmen and women foot the bill for wildlife management in Arizona with their licenses and tag fees. In 1990, California voters turned their mountain lion management over to the ballot box. The result...California taxpayers now pay to kill depredating mountain lions. The California Fish and Game Department annually issues approximately 250 depredation tags to kill (manage) their mountain lions.
